Output 1869d51aa12330d216267fa957aa32837c43d8821b3a52359cdf40dc6c1c4456:2

value
869193
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 188a37b84661a463956e1023f0d6779671fe282e OP_EQUALVERIFY OP_CHECKSIG
address
mhki6Bv7t6vrdfp4sQX3bSXF2AUake1ywp
transaction
1869d51aa12330d216267fa957aa32837c43d8821b3a52359cdf40dc6c1c4456
confirmations
42888
spent
true